(Anonymous) 2014-05-22 12:15 am (UTC)(link)" Winter Clothing
Fur cap (Klondike or Columbia pattern); fur coat or pea jacket (according to weather); black or blue knee stockings and moccasins or felt ankle boots (according to weather); mittens or gloves. Northern divisions issue native clothing as needed. Fur caps or forage caps and peacoats or fur coats worn with Service Order or Review Order in winter as ordered."
